`semantic-release` in `release.plugin.yml` creates a commit that is necessary for the native publish (version update), but those workflows still reference the the (older) commit from triggering the release GitHub action. By pull, we make sure main is synced when trying to release.

Description
Found a few issues that caused the publishing of the plugin to Maven Central and CocoaPods to fail:
semantic-release, found that the commit it was checking out was the one that existed when the GitHub action is triggered, and not the one after runningsemantic-release. This caused the workflow to try and publish a 8.0.0-next.X version to Maven Central / CocoaPods, which shouldn't happen.This PR fixes those issues.
